    NVIDIA Isaac Sim Reviews
    NVIDIA Isaac Sim is a free and open-source robotics simulation tool that operates on the NVIDIA Omniverse platform, allowing developers to create, simulate, evaluate, and train AI-powered robots within highly realistic virtual settings. Utilizing Universal Scene Description (OpenUSD), it provides extensive customization options, enabling users to build tailored simulators or to incorporate the functionalities of Isaac Sim into their existing validation frameworks effortlessly. The platform facilitates three core processes: the generation of large-scale synthetic datasets for training foundational models with lifelike rendering and automatic ground truth labeling; software-in-the-loop testing that links real robot software to simulated hardware for validating control and perception systems; and robot learning facilitated by NVIDIA’s Isaac Lab, which hastens the training of robot behaviors in a simulated environment before they are deployed in the real world. Additionally, Isaac Sim features GPU-accelerated physics through NVIDIA PhysX and offers RTX-enabled sensor simulations, empowering developers to refine their robotic systems.     NVIDIA Isaac Lab Reviews
    NVIDIA Isaac Lab is an open-source robot learning framework that utilizes GPU acceleration and is built upon Isaac Sim, aimed at streamlining and integrating various robotics research processes such as reinforcement learning, imitation learning, and motion planning. By harnessing highly realistic sensor and physics simulations, it enables the effective training of embodied agents and offers a wide range of pre-configured environments that include manipulators, quadrupeds, and humanoids, while supporting over 30 benchmark tasks and seamless integration with well-known RL libraries, including RL Games, Stable Baselines, RSL RL, and SKRL. The design of Isaac Lab is modular and configuration-driven, which allows developers to effortlessly create, adjust, and expand their learning environments; it also provides the ability to gather demonstrations through peripherals like gamepads and keyboards, as well as facilitating the use of custom actuator models to improve sim-to-real transfer processes. Furthermore, the framework is designed to operate effectively in both local and cloud environments, ensuring that compute resources can be scaled flexibly to meet varying demands.     NVIDIA Cosmos Reviews
    NVIDIA Cosmos serves as a cutting-edge platform tailored for developers, featuring advanced generative World Foundation Models (WFMs), sophisticated video tokenizers, safety protocols, and a streamlined data processing and curation system aimed at enhancing the development of physical AI. This platform empowers developers who are focused on areas such as autonomous vehicles, robotics, and video analytics AI agents to create highly realistic, physics-informed synthetic video data, leveraging an extensive dataset that encompasses 20 million hours of both actual and simulated footage, facilitating the rapid simulation of future scenarios, the training of world models, and the customization of specific behaviors. The platform comprises three primary types of WFMs: Cosmos Predict, which can produce up to 30 seconds of continuous video from various input modalities; Cosmos Transfer, which modifies simulations to work across different environments and lighting conditions for improved domain augmentation; and Cosmos Reason, a vision-language model that implements structured reasoning to analyze spatial-temporal information for effective planning and decision-making.     Calculix Reviews
    CalculiX allows users to create, analyze, and process finite element models efficiently. It features an interactive 3D pre-and post-processor that utilizes the OpenGL API for enhanced visualization. The solver within CalculiX is capable of handling both linear and non-linear calculations, offering solutions for static, dynamic, and thermal problems. Since it employs the Abaqus input format, users can leverage commercial pre-processors seamlessly. Furthermore, the pre-processor can generate mesh-related data compatible with Nastran, Abaqus, Ansys, Code-Aster, as well as free computational fluid dynamics tools such as Dolfyn, Duns, ISAAC, and OpenFOAM. A straightforward step reader is also integrated into the system. Additionally, there are options for external CAD interfaces, broadening its usability. This versatile program is designed to operate on various Unix platforms like Linux and Irix, as well as on MS Windows, making it accessible to a wide range of users.

    Webots Reviews
    Cyberbotics' Webots is a versatile, open-source desktop application that operates across multiple platforms, specifically designed for the modeling, programming, and simulation of robotic systems. This tool provides an extensive development environment, complete with a rich library of assets including robots, sensors, actuators, objects, and materials, which streamlines the prototyping process and enhances the efficiency of robotics project development. Additionally, users have the capability to import pre-existing CAD models from software such as Blender or URDF and can incorporate OpenStreetMap data to enrich their simulations with real-world mapping. Webots accommodates various programming languages, such as C, C++, Python, Java, MATLAB, and ROS, which allows developers the flexibility to choose the best fit for their specific needs. Its contemporary graphical user interface, in conjunction with a robust physics engine and OpenGL rendering, facilitates the realistic simulation of a wide range of robotic systems, including wheeled robots, industrial arms, legged robots, drones, and autonomous vehicles. The application sees widespread use in industries, educational institutions, and research environments for purposes such as robot prototyping, AI algorithm development, and testing innovative robotic concepts.     Gazebo Reviews
    Gazebo serves as an open-source simulator for robotics, offering a high level of fidelity in physics, visual rendering, and sensor modeling, which is essential for the development and testing of robotic applications. It accommodates various physics engines, such as ODE, Bullet, and Simbody, which facilitate precise dynamics simulation. The platform boasts sophisticated 3D graphics capabilities through rendering engines like OGRE v2, producing immersive environments enriched with realistic lighting, shadows, and textures. Gazebo comes equipped with a diverse set of sensors, including laser range finders, 2D and 3D cameras, IMUs, and GPS, along with features to emulate sensor noise. Users have the opportunity to create custom plugins to enhance robot, sensor, and environmental control and can engage with the simulations through a plugin-based graphical interface powered by the Gazebo GUI. Additionally, Gazebo provides a library of various robot models, such as the PR2, Pioneer2 DX, iRobot Create, and TurtleBot, while also allowing users to design their own models utilizing the SDF format.     Evo 2 Reviews
    Evo 2 represents a cutting-edge genomic foundation model that excels in making predictions and designing tasks related to DNA, RNA, and proteins. It employs an advanced deep learning architecture that allows for the modeling of biological sequences with single-nucleotide accuracy, achieving impressive scaling of both compute and memory resources as the context length increases. With a robust training of 40 billion parameters and a context length of 1 megabase, Evo 2 has analyzed over 9 trillion nucleotides sourced from a variety of eukaryotic and prokaryotic genomes. This extensive dataset facilitates Evo 2's ability to conduct zero-shot function predictions across various biological types, including DNA, RNA, and proteins, while also being capable of generating innovative sequences that maintain a plausible genomic structure. The model's versatility has been showcased through its effectiveness in designing operational CRISPR systems and in the identification of mutations that could lead to diseases in human genes. Furthermore, Evo 2 is available to the public on Arc's GitHub repository, and it is also incorporated into the NVIDIA BioNeMo framework, enhancing its accessibility for researchers and developers alike.
